Well, no, actually, that puppet was built (and photographed) for Ghost Story. Take a look at Cinefantastique Vol 12 #1.

Anyone who has seen Sleepwalkers will recall the scene when Alice Krige looks at a cat near her...for a moment she transforms into that puppet and back. That happens 2-3 times in the movie. Also I have seen the same prop in Ghost Story. So I am pretty sure thats it. Proofs :- http://www.geocities.com/alicekrigefan/Krige19sm.jpg http://www.geocities.com/alicekrigefan/Krige20sm.jpg |
My God, you're right! What I have seen of Sleepwalkers, I saw absent-mindedly and wasn't really paying attention. But yeah, Dick Smith was supposedly disappointed that the puppet wasn't used in Ghost Story because it looked so startling...a sort of a naked-boob nightmare creature.
KNB built a lookalike puppet for some movie, maybe one of the Wishmaster films or one of those movies that features "lots of different monsters"...thumbing through some Fangorias would probably reveal what movie that is... |
